Turnover in trade increased by 2.1 per cent in January

According to Statistics Finland, turnover in total trade adjusted for working days increased by 2.1 per cent in January from January 2019. Over the same period, the working day adjusted volume of sales, from which the impact of prices has been eliminated, rose by 1.2 per cent. Among trade industries, retail trade and motor vehicle trade grew most. Turnover in retail trade increased by 3.6 per cent and in motor vehicle trade by 4.3 per cent compared to the previous year. Wholesale trade reached a slight growth of 0.7 per cent.

Working day adjusted turnover in retail trade was 3.6 per cent higher in January than in January 2019. Sales volume grew by 3.3 per cent during the same period. The growth in retail trade was especially boosted by specialised store trade, as working day adjusted turnover in this industry grew by 5.7 per cent and sales volume by 7.2 per cent. In daily consumer goods trade, turnover grew by 3.8 per cent and sales volume by 1.6 per cent. Turnover in department store trade, in turn, fell slightly (-0.3%) from January 2019. The big difference in the development of working day adjusted turnover and sales volume in daily consumer goods trade is due to a rise in prices and, correspondingly, in specialised store trade by a fall in prices.

Turnover and sales volume increased month-on-month

Seasonally adjusted turnover in total trade increased in January by 0.9 per cent compared to December 2019. Sales volume grew by 0.6 per cent during the same period. In December 2019, turnover and sales volume both remained almost on level with the previous month.

The calculation of indices of turnover of trade is based on the Tax Administration’s data on self-assessed taxes, which are supplemented with Statistics Finland’s sales inquiry. The volume index of sales is calculated by removing the effect of price changes from the value index series.

The factors caused by the variation in the number of weekdays are taken into account in adjustment for working days. This means taking into consideration the lengths of months, different weekdays and holidays. In addition, seasonal variation is eliminated from seasonally adjusted series, on account of which it makes sense to compare observations of two successive months as well.

The data for the latest month are preliminary and they may become significantly revised particularly on more detailed industry levels in coming months.
